Abstract

Consumption of power by highway lights constitutes a big component of the total power usage of a country. In a country like India where the majority of the transport is by road and with one of the largest road network the power consumption by highway lighting has to be controlled. We can see in the present scenario that the lights are manually switched ON/OFF or in some stretches automatic switching ON/OFF based on daylight detection is being done. We can see that the lights were ON, when there was no vehicle in a particular stretch. Switching OFF the light when there are no vehicles would results in great savings of power. Our proposed system does this by detecting vehicles on the road and switching ON the lights. We are proposing a system wherein the lights gets switch ON when a vehicle is detected. It remains ON for a present period of time and gets switched OFF. When the vehicle passes the next detector the corresponding light gets switched ON and so on. We are sure that this system when implemented would result in huge savings in the current consumption
